Transaction 96d7a679d4b4817dc1897e9ee301da5461c3e765318845221e41e4c19c31e16e

1 Input
2 Outputs
  • 96d7a679d4b4817dc1897e9ee301da5461c3e765318845221e41e4c19c31e16e:0
  • value  6028261
    address  1BEbB2YeacvkWftJnXwEU5rrLqcCHZjHN3
  • 96d7a679d4b4817dc1897e9ee301da5461c3e765318845221e41e4c19c31e16e:1
  • value  137114166
    address  14QcQ5sh9HDTd6GTtxnQomZoZJPh6XRbDD